What youll notice on the apex is you sink into the seat quite a bit.Apex has a softer foam density.Sit on a nitro as well(same basic seat but firmer foam) and you will notice the difference.Apex MOUNTAIN has the firm foam as well but requires rewiring because the connectors are different from the rx1.

Im 6' tall myself the transision from sitting to standing is much easier with the taller seat.

Also the nitro seat has the correct plugins for the rx1 so you wont have to do any rewireing.
 
Being 6'2" myself, I found that after a day of riding my Vector hard, I found that my knees were quite sore at the end of the day. I too like to tuck my feet under my body so I can quickly stand up and absord the bumps.

I purchased a Mountain Mod seat this past summer and installed it and what an awesome difference it is. When sitting and my feet are in the footholds, my knees are actually slightly lower than my hips. I can now tuck in my legs and ride hard without the discomfort as before with the stock seat. The seat is much taller (even more than that of the Nytro seat, I measured), firmer, and comfortable for long rides as well. I certainly noticed the increased wind and am subsequently colder in the hands, but nothing that my hand warmers can't handle.

The Mountain Mod seat also uses stock hardware, but you must transfer over your wiring, tailight, mounting hardware and heat shielding. A great upgrade to us larger riders. ;)!
